A 24-volt mechanical thermostat generally accepts only two wires, an incoming hot wire from the transformer (usually red) and an outgoing load wire (usually white). … Web17 de jan. de 2024 · Follow these steps to replace an old two-wire thermostat with a new two-wire model. Note: This procedure is for low-voltage (not line voltage) thermostats only. 1. Turn Off the Power. Locate the circuit breaker in the main electrical panel (breaker box) that controls the heating system, and turn it off.

First of all, make sure you will be able to correctly wire the new thermostat. HVAC … Ver mais The most basic thermostat has 2 wires; usually a red and a white wire. Two wire thermostat wiring is used for furnaces only and usually doesn’t need a “C” or “Common” wire. That’s why we only need two wires.
